In seismic prospecting, for signal generation, is used various sources – explosive, gas, hammer and other. Energy transmitted substantially differ from source to source and hence the depth of investigation. For better understanding of the phenomenon we attached a table of advantages and limitation in seismic energy sources.
| Type | Source | Energy into ground | Field portability | Cost | Relative dipth investigation [m] | Aplications |
| Impact | Sledge hammer | Small | Excellent | Low | < 30 | Engineering, environmental |
| Weight drop | Small-medium | Poor | High | 30 - 60 | ||
| Impulsive | Shotgun | Medium | Fair | High | 100 | Engineering |
| Explosives | Small-large | Excellent | Low | No limit | Land, hidrocarbon | |
| Vibratory | Vibroseis | Small-large | Fair | Medium | >1 000 | Land, hidrocarbon |
